The Timneh African Grey Parrot: A Comprehensive Guide
The Timneh African Grey parrot (Psittacus erithacus timneh) is an impressive bird renowned for its intelligence, striking look, and engaging character. As a subspecies of the African grey parrot, it offers bird lovers a captivating companion. This post dives into the attributes, care requirements, and behavioral propensities of the Timneh African Grey parrot, while also addressing some frequently asked questions about this captivating bird pal.

Physical Appearance
The Timneh african grey parrot baby for sale Grey parrot includes a slate-grey body, darker with a lighter underbelly. Significant is the maroon-colored shine on the tail feathers, which provides this bird a distinct appreciable quality. Their beak is short and strong, enabling them to break nuts and seeds successfully.
Personality type
Popular for their sociable and spirited nature, Timneh African Grey parrots typically bond well with their owners. Unlike some birds that choose solitude, Timnehs grow on interaction and might display indications of dullness if not appropriately engaged. Their intelligence is noteworthy, as they can find out an outstanding array of words and expressions, typically simulating sounds from their environment.
Care Requirements
Caring for a Timneh African Grey parrot involves specific needs. Below are necessary elements of their care:
Diet
A well balanced diet is important for their health. A common diet plan may include:
- Pellets: A high-quality formulated diet developed for parrots.
- Fresh Fruits and Vegetables: Options such as apples, carrots, and leafy greens are exceptional choices.
- Nuts and Seeds: Provided as a periodic reward, they ought to not control the diet.
Real estate
Providing a large and appealing environment is essential. Here are some recommendations:
- Cage Size: The cage needs to be large enough for the bird to move comfortably (minimum 24 x 24 x 36 inches).
- Perches: A range of perches at different heights and textures can help keep their feet healthy.
- Toys: Interactive toys that promote play and curiosity are important for psychological stimulation.
Social Interaction
Timneh African Greys need significant interaction with their caregivers. Daily socialization is useful, and owners must intend to spend time talking with and having fun with their birds.
Health Care
Routine veterinary check-ups are vital to ensure ideal health. Typical health concerns for African grey parrots might include:
- Psittacosis: A bacterial infection that can impact birds and human beings alike.
- Feather Plucking: Behavioral concerns causing plume loss.
- Weight problems: Often due to a sedentary lifestyle or poor diet.
Training Tips
Training Timneh African Grey parrots can be extremely gratifying. Here are some efficient training approaches:
- Positive Reinforcement: Use deals with and praise to encourage wanted behaviors.
- Brief Sessions: Training sessions need to be short (10-15 minutes) to hold their attention without tiring them.
- Consistency: Regular practice helps enhance learning and understanding of commands.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How can I inform if my Timneh African Grey enjoys?
Indications of a happy Timneh might consist of vocalizations, lively habits, and a healthy cravings. A bird that fluffs its plumes and displays interest is typically content.
2. The length of time do Timneh African Grey parrots live?
With proper care, Timneh African Grey parrots can live in between 40 to 60 years, making them a long-lasting commitment for potential owners.
3. Are Timneh African Grey parrots loud?
While they can be singing, Timnehs are normally quieter than their Congo counterparts. However, they may still make noises, particularly if bored or seeking interaction.
4. Can Timneh African Grey parrots learn to talk?
Yes, Timneh African Grey parrots are renowned for their ability to simulate human speech. With constant practice and encouragement, they can discover a broad array of words and expressions.
5. Is it difficult to care for a Timneh African Grey?
Taking care of a Timneh African Grey requires devotion and understanding. While they can have requiring needs, the gratifying nature of their friendship makes it beneficial for lots of owners.
